Foreseeing great potential in the applications of PCT technology in large-size displays, CMI has taken the lead in relevant R&D, successfully developing the 21.5-inch PCT display module, achieving a significant breakthrough for the industry. In addition to its multi-touch and pad-style design, the integration of touch panels into the display module will help customers save time assembling the system. In anticipation of the launch of Windows 8 in 2012, multi-touch technology enabling page turning, window resizing and image rotation at the touch of fingertips will be widely used in netbooks, notebooks and all-in-one desktop PCs. As a result, there will be an inevitable surge in demand for large-size PCT products supporting multi-touch functionality. Possessing technologies spanning multiple fields, including display panels, touch panels and system assembly, CMI has the advantage over other competitors in launching medium- and large-size integrated PCT products. In the future, if touch functionality is introduced into a multitude of displays, the technology and innovation to develop such products will allow CMI to strongly boost customers’ cost and time-to-market competitiveness. |
